24.01.2022 In 2018, almost two-thirds of Australian organisations indicate older worker departures have caused a loss of key skills and knowledge in their organisation (an increase of 17 per cent in four years) . Unfortunately, in the same period there has also been an eight per cent reduction in using mentoring programs to facilitate knowledge transfer between older and younger workers.
